Output 31108838bfc1c49dc8182094ad4e12426a87a07933b9300b1aa689687d49ba85:0

value
2040041956
script pubkey
OP_HASH160 OP_PUSHBYTES_20 daf2de8f0963c3852a496250694949f6c7aa63e0 OP_EQUAL
address
ACPxv4vV7GGp7EghJEE55Wmmf3YnB9QrLq
transaction
31108838bfc1c49dc8182094ad4e12426a87a07933b9300b1aa689687d49ba85